Connecticut Coastline and Expanding Salt Marshes
Figure 16.7
The Nature ConservancyAdam Whelchel
This figure appears in chapter 16 of the Climate Change Impacts in the United States: The Third National Climate Assessment report.
The Nature Conservancyâs adaptation decision-support tool (www.coastalresilience.org)b1a2614f-8ace-49a0-8613-ea30d7fb6f28 depicts building-level impacts due to inundation (developed land cover, yellow areas) and potential marsh advancement zones (undeveloped land cover â currently forest, grass, and agriculture â blue areas) using downscaled sea level rise projections (52 inches by 2080s depicted) along the Connecticut and New York coasts.
